anti-incest
adjEtymology
From anti- + incest.
- learned borrowing from incestus
Definitions
Opposed to incest.
- The mistake on the part of the anti-incest taboo protagonists is not their insistence that we recognize the conventional features of our social arrangements […]
- Of course, most systems have some failure rate — incest does occur, because innate behaviors direct rather than dictate (chimps also have an occasional anti-incest failure).
- Even when we're at our most arbitrary and forgetful of our own stance, we remain antibestiality and anti-incest.
